It wasn't until 2002 that the public came to a fuller understanding of John F. Kennedy's health while in office. Medical files opened up to historian Robert Dallek showed that he took painkillers, anti-anxiety agents, stimulants, and sleeping pills, as well as hormones to keep him alive,...

In the summer of 2007, after several years of growth in the number of passengers and airlines it served, John F. Kennedy International Airport experienced a huge spike in flight delays. On-time departures fell to just 50% — a 15% drop from the previous year — and planes often waited ...
